BT’s latest ‘broadband nightmares’ campaign showcases its Halo 3+ Hybrid Broadband

BT’s most recent campaign, “Broadband Nightmares”, features a short horror film that showcases “the power” of the company’s Halo 3+ Hybrid Broadband in resisting slow WiFi connection.

The TV advertisement spot dramatises internet outages in a family household, specifically the family dad’s nightmares about lagging internet connection.

The Saatchi & Saatchi created campaign follows the success of the creative agency’s “Broadband Rage” campaign last year, which highlighted the “unbreakable” connection of BT’s hybrid broadband.

This year, the telecommunication company’s campaign falls into the genre of horror, with imagery depicting the family’s nightmare-like version of reality when the WiFi goes down. The son struggles to download a film, the daughter cannot use her iPad and the mum despairs as her zoom call freezes.

All is saved however, when a BT and EE  router appear next to each other; “Together BT and EE bring you Unbreakable WiFi. Only BT’s hybrid broadband is backed up by EE the UK’s best mobile network”.

The 30 second video launched on 6 May and will also run across out of home (OOH) and video on demand (VOD), with edits and content developed specifically for a range of digital and social channels.

“We are spending more time at home, especially due to the increase in hybrid working. That’s why it is so important to have a network you can rely on,” BT and EE marketing communications director, Pete Jeavons, said.

“Our new and refreshed campaign highlights our unbreakable Halo 3+ hybrid broadband and reminds our customers and viewers that BT and EE provide the enviable connection needed to get on with the day.”
